Gift wrap gift boxes

Project and image courtesy of Spotlight.

What you’ll need

  • Assorted Paper Mache gift boxes
  • Burlap
  • Hot glue gun and glue sticks
  • Faux floristry and leaves
  • Twine
  • Wooden flourishes
  • Black fine liner
  • Pencil
  • Scissors

Method

Decide on which box size you need/want for your gift.

Cut the burlap to desired thickness and glue on the inside of box lid with the hot glue gun. This way it is easy to open the box without ruining the look of it.

Choose what words you would like to put on your presents and use a pencil to lightly draw that word onto the wooden flourish. Then draw over that word with black fine liner to make it stand out.

Pull apart the faux floristry and eucalyptus plants and create small little bouquets to put on top of your presents. Use a small amount of the hot glue to glue the stems together or tie together with twine.

Now you can decorate your different gift boxes with combinations of all the different elements you have created.
